Creating a New CSA under New York Law: ISDA and IHS Markit Tutorial Series

ISDA and IHS Markit have collaborated to bring together a three part pre-recorded tutorial series to show you how you can create a new CSA under NY Law. The tutorials will explore: The New CSA being created; ISDA Amend – demo using a specific customer use case; and How the exhibit to the protocol is used to create a New CSA.
